Why it’s a travesty that Caster Semenya won’t compete at the Paris Olympics
By Michael Sherman | Published Apr 28, 2024
By Michael Sherman | Published Apr 28, 2024
By Supplied | Published Apr 27, 2024
By Matshelane Mamabolo | Published Apr 25, 2024
By AFP | Published Apr 23, 2024
By Greg Hutson | Published Apr 23, 2024
By AFP | Published Apr 21, 2024
By AFP | Published Apr 21, 2024
By Ashfak Mohamed | Published Apr 20, 2024
By Supplied | Published Apr 20, 2024
By Ashfak Mohamed | Published Apr 19, 2024
By Ashfak Mohamed | Published Apr 19, 2024
By Keagan Mitchell | Published Apr 19, 2024
By AFP | Published Apr 19, 2024
By AFP | Published Apr 19, 2024
By Ashfak Mohamed | Published Apr 19, 2024
By AFP | Published Apr 18, 2024